Final list of R.T. Nagar site allottees published

August 12, 2017

Mysuru: The Mysuru Urban Development Authority (MUDA) has yesterday published the final list of site allottees of R.T. Nagar layout. The final list was prepared after dropping the names of 105 allottees whose names were mentioned in the provisional list. SC to hear Ayodhya case on Dec. 5

August 12, 2017

New Delhi: The Supreme Court yesterday granted three months time for translating the historic documents in the two-decade-old Ayodhya dispute. The Apex Court fixed the matter for further hearing on Dec. 5.
